📜  门| GATE-CS-2017(Set 1)|第59章

📅  最后修改于: 2021-06-29 11:25:44             🧑  作者: Mango

考虑具有关系架构CR(StudentName,CourseName)的数据库。模式CR的实例如下所示。

g20172_10

在数据库上进行以下查询。

T1←π课程名称( σStudentName =’SA’ (CR))

T2←CR÷T1

T2中的行数是________。

注意:此问题显示为数值答案类型。

(A) 2
(B) 3
(C) 4
(D) 5答案: (C)
说明: T1的结果:
认证机构
认证机构
抄送

T2的结果= CR / T1
南非
SC
标清
SF
总数= 4
因此,选项C是正确的
替代解决方案:
查询T1的输出将是学生SA所注册的课程,即CA,CB,CC

查询T2的输出将是报名参加查询T1输出的所有课程的学生的姓名(除法运算符),即CA,CB,CC
从表中可以看到,SA,SC,SD,SF已经注册了所有课程,因此T2的输出将有4行。
该解决方案由parul sharma贡献这个问题的测验